Abstract
A kind of axle portion structure of upside down machine, including:Handstand grillage and one that one support body, one are hubbed on the support body are mounted on the foot's fixed mount below handstand grillage, two sides of the support body are respectively provided with leader, so that user is lain on handstand grillage, pin is fixed on foot's fixed mount, and handstand campaign is carried out to hold handle;Wherein, the side of support body two is respectively provided with an axle portion, be pivoted a bracket that can be rotated along the axle portion in these axle portions, so that the handstand grillage is fixed on the bracket, the axle portion includes a positioning pipe, bearing is provided with positioning pipe, the bracket is provided with a body of rod, make two bearings that the body of rod is arranged in the axle portion, when bracket is when rotating, by the body of rod that two bearings rotate, to keep the center of axle portion and control the motion of the body of rod, so that the rotation of the bracket is more smoothly and stable.

Specific embodiment
Please refer to Fig. 1 and Fig. 2, and coordinate Fig. 3, it is the three-dimensional exploded view of upside down machine of the present utility model, solid
The three-dimensional exploded view of figure and axle portion structure.As illustrated, the utility model includes:One support body 1, is hubbed on the support body 1
Handstand grillage 2 and be mounted on foot's fixed mount 3 of the lower section of the handstand grillage 2, two sides of the support body 1 are respectively provided with an axle
Portion 4 and leader 11 is respectively provided with, the both sides of handstand grillage 2 is hubbed at respectively in the axle portion 4, be able to be overturn along the axle portion 4, with
Lain on the handstand grillage 2 for user, pin is fixed on foot's fixed mount 3, and turned over handstand grillage 2 with holding handle 11
Turn to carry out handstand campaign.The handstand grillage 2 is respectively equipped with locating rod 21 in both sides appropriate location.
The axle portion 4 of the both sides of the support body 1 includes positioning pipe 41 and lid 42, and rank is respectively arranged at two ends with the inner edge of positioning pipe 41
Portion 411, so that two bearings 43 are embedded in the rank portion 411 respectively, the lid 42 is provided with fixing hole 421.
The axle portion 4 of the support body 1 is pivoted with bracket 5 respectively, and the bracket 5 is provided with a L-shape lamellar body 51, in the lamellar body 51
The body of rod 52 of upper limb horizontal projection one, screw 521 is provided with the end of the body of rod 52, and lower section is provided with a bearing portion 53, makes the bracket 5 with bar
After body 52 is arranged in two bearings 43 in axle portion 4, this is locked in after wearing the fixing hole 421 of lid 42 for a fixture 44
On screw 521, the body of rod 52 is freely rotated along the axle portion 4, freely rotated relative to the bracket 5 is made.
The axle portion structure of upside down machine is constituted by the combination of aforementioned components.When upside down machine is assembled, first by 2 liang of handstand grillage
The locating rod 21 of side is placed in the bearing portion 53 of bracket 5, the handstand grillage 2 is constituted positioning, then the locating rod 21 is locked in into this
On bracket 5.When user is lain on handstand grillage 2, pin is fixed on foot's fixed mount 3, and will be fallen with holding handle 11
Vertical board support 2 is overturn to carry out handstand campaign, and the body of rod 52 of bracket 5 is able to be rotated in two bearings 43 in axle portion 4, by two
The body of rod 52 of the support rotation of individual bearing 43, the center for keeping axle portion 4 and the motion for controlling the body of rod 52, make it rotate more
It is smooth, and then make handstand grillage 2 more smoothly, more flexible and stabilization, and the friction between the body of rod 52 and axle portion 4 can be reduced,
To improve the service life of upside down machine.
